
(Patria) - According to this morning's measurements, the air in Sarajevo is polluted and unhealthy, and citizens are recommended to stay indoors. The air quality index is 158, and pollutants PM2.5 and PM10 are present in the air.
"Possible exacerbation of symptoms and intensity of diseases in people with heart and respiratory diseases, such as asthma. All others could begin to feel the negative impact of pollution on their health.
The following groups should reduce any outdoor physical activity: people with lung and heart diseases, pregnant women, children, and the elderly. Prolonged or strenuous exertion during outdoor activities should also be avoided by everyone else," it is stated.
